Short ID: FC23. Title: Chacone. Composer: Francois Campion. Source: Nouvelles decouvertes sur la Guitarre. Page 13. Date: 1705. Facsimile: Minkoff (1977), page 35. Tuning: Bb D G C F (tuning 1). Time sig: 3. Fixes and modifications (M=measure r=rhythm s=string): M31r2 original showed no rhythm symbol. 8th symbol added here. Tablature elements to be added by hand: Slurs. If only a starting point is given, slur includes all the following uninterrupted notes on the same string. M6 r4s1, r7s2. Take a moment to fill out the 16th-note beams. Strums: Arrowheads ^ and v indicate strums. Open strings in strummed chords were not shown in the tablature; add as many open strings as sound good. Consider writing in the additional notes you decide on. M5r2 the interpretation is to add the new note to the previous chord and strum the whole chord. Regarding consecutive strums-to-the-bass (i.e., toward the ceiling assuming an upright guitarist holding the guitar in a reasonably conventional manner - you're not going to hear me say "up-strum" or "down-strum"!), I think strokes with the back of the thumb nail followed by a finger may be intended. For example, consider ppi or ppm in m1 and at the beginning of m21. But I'm not the expert. Take a moment to re-draw the ^ arrowhead right at the top of the associated stem, just under the beam if a beam is present. Explanation of symbols: " = trill (starting on upper neighbor). , = mordent. There are none in this piece. . = do not strum this string in the chord. Trill clarification: m42r1s2 upper neighbor shown to be fret b (=1). Octave doublings: To keep certain musical lines intact on the modern guitar, consider adding or substituting the next octave up. For example, see: m7r3 and m30r2. Performance style: consider playing the 8th notes inegales, that is, as dotted 8ths or "swing" 8ths (triplet feel). Leading measures in Campion's original tablature: 1 6 10 14 18 23 27 31 37 41.
